首页 > 计算机类考试> IT/互联网
题目内容 (请给出正确答案)
[主观题]

在Java中,对象什么时候可以被垃圾回收?

查看答案
答案
收藏
如果结果不匹配,请 联系老师 获取答案
您可能会需要:
您的账号:,可能还需要:
您的账号:
发送账号密码至手机
发送
安装优题宝APP,拍照搜题省时又省心!
更多“在Java中,对象什么时候可以被垃圾回收?”相关的问题
第1题
Java中垃圾回收有什么目的?什么时候进行垃圾回收?

点击查看答案
第2题
下列是对finaly的理解正确的是()

A.无论是否抛出异常,finally代码块总是会被执行。就算是没有catch语句同时又抛出异常的情况下,finally代码块仍然会被执行

B.finaly要结合catch块才可以运行,单独运行的话会报运行时异常

C.finaly是Object中的一个方法,在垃圾收集器执行的时候会调用被回收对象的此方法

D.可以覆盖finaly方法提供垃圾收集时的其他资源回收,例如关闭文件等

点击查看答案
第3题
下面Java对象的构造过程正确的有那些?()

A.需要为对象开辟主存空间

B.需要调用垃圾回收器构造父类

C.需要对成员变量进行指定的初始化

D.需要调用构造方法

点击查看答案
第4题
下列()语句关于Java中内存回收的说明是正确的。A.程序员必须创建一个线程来释放内存B.内存回收程

下列()语句关于Java中内存回收的说明是正确的。

A.程序员必须创建一个线程来释放内存

B.内存回收程序允许程序员直接释放内存

C.内存回收程序负责释放无用内存

D.内存回收程序可以在指定的时间释放内存对象

点击查看答案
第5题
设有Circle类,执行下面语句后,哪个对象可以被垃圾回收器回收()。Circlea=newCircle();Circleb=newCircle();Circlec=newCircle();a=b;b=c;c=null;

A.原来a所指的对象

B.原来b所指的对象

C.原来b和c所指的对象

D.原来c所指的对象

点击查看答案
第6题
关于垃圾回收机制描述不正确的是()。

A.垃圾回收机制不须通过程序员调用相应方法,也能自动启动。

B.java程序员用System.gc()方法一定能进行垃圾回收;

C.垃圾回收机制属于jvm自动操作,java程序员可以不进行垃圾回收操作。

D.垃圾回收机制并不是由操作系统自动执行。

点击查看答案
第7题
以下关于JVM的理解,正确的有()

A.当一个类加载器收到加载类的请求时,先尝试自己加载类,自己加载不了则委派父类加载器来加载

B.基本类型的变量和对象的引用变量都是在栈中分配内存

C.数组和new出来的对象都是在堆中分配内存

D.垃圾回收器GC会在合适的时候由系统自动调用,可以通过调用System.gc来立即执行垃圾回收

点击查看答案
第8题

下列关于Java对象释放的说法中不正确的是:()。

A.Java中,程序员只需要创建对象,而释放对象的工作则由虚拟机自动完成

B.Java中垃圾收集是比较费时的,因此其优先级较低,一般在系统空闲时才执行

C.Java中,垃圾收集可通过程序调用System.gc()方法在任意时刻进行

D.Java中对象释放是由程序员编写析构函数来完成的

点击查看答案
第9题
下列关于Java特点的描述中错误的是()

A、Java语言不支持指针

B、Java具有自动垃圾回收的机制

C、Java只能运行在Window和Linux平台

D、Java允许多个线程同时执行

点击查看答案
第10题
编写Java程序时,如果一个对象没有用了应该如何处理()?

A.必须用delete语句回收对象占用的内存

B.可以不用处理,Java会自动定时回收没用的对象所占用的内存

C.调用对象的finalize方法回收对象占用的内存和资源

D.如果对象占用了其他资源,应该先释放掉

点击查看答案
退出 登录/注册
发送账号至手机
密码将被重置
获取验证码
发送
温馨提示
该问题答案仅针对搜题卡用户开放,请点击购买搜题卡。
马上购买搜题卡
我已购买搜题卡, 登录账号 继续查看答案
重置密码
确认修改